Emixa blog

Fouten bij de implementatie van SAP S/4HANA voorkomen

Geschreven door Patrick Beks | 4 mrt 2024 3:23:00 PM

Sinds de eerste release van SAP S/4HANA in 2014, heeft SAP's nieuwste ERP oplossing een aanzienlijke ontwikkeling doorgemaakt. Wat begon als Simple Finance, een 'next-gen' financiële oplossing, is nu een volledig revolutionair ERP systeem geworden. Hoewel het systeem zeker niet nieuw is, worden er in de praktijk nog wel eens verkeerde implementatiekeuzes gemaakt.

Deze verkeerde keuzes worden gemaakt omdat traditionele implementatiemethoden niet altijd passen bij zo'n revolutionair en modern ERP platform. Zonde, want de kracht van S/4 wordt niet optimaal benut. Benieuwd naar deze fouten? En nog belangrijker: benieuwd naar hoe deze voorkomen kunnen worden? Je leest het in deze blog.

Valkuil 1: Ongebruikt analytisch inzicht

Om deze implementatievalkuil te begrijpen is het goed om meer te weten over IT en database architecturen. SAP had namelijk grote ambities met haar visie op S/4. Naast het robotiseren van administratieve handelingen die geen waarde toevoegen, kun je door middel van RPA en Machine Learning denken aan meer real-time en zelfs voorspellend inzicht.

Al deze ambities hebben één ding gemeen: ze vereisen een nieuwe gebruikersinterface die controleert op uitzonderingen en meer analytische functies mogelijk maakt. Om dit mogelijk te maken, was een geheel nieuwe database nodig.

De twee traditionele IT-systemen in SAP

Traditioneel zijn er twee systemen, namelijk Online Analytische Verwerking (OLAP) en Online Transactionele Verwerking (OLTP). Het belangrijkste verschil tussen de twee systemen is het doel. Een OLAP-systeem is ontworpen om snel grote hoeveelheden gegevens te verwerken, zodat gebruikers snel meerdere dimensies van gegevens kunnen analyseren voor besluitvorming en analyse. Anderzijds zijn OLTP-systemen bedoeld om grote hoeveelheden transactiegegevens van meerdere gebruikers te verwerken. Ze werken met relationele databases en kunnen kleine hoeveelheden gegevens in realtime bijwerken. Hoewel beide systemen goed zijn afgestemd op hun specifieke taken, brengt de scheiding ook nadelen met zich mee, zoals het gebrek aan real-time gegevens analyse en reactieve rapportage. Het is belangrijk om te streven naar analytische begeleiding van uitzonderingen en automatisering van het operationele proces voor operationele uitmuntendheid.

SAP HANA als nieuwe database

SAP stond daarom voor de enorme uitdaging om de eigenschappen van beide systemen in één systeem te verenigen. Deze ambitie resulteerde in de HANA-database, die optimaal analytisch inzicht biedt.

Hoe heeft SAP dat voor elkaar gekregen? Magie? Nou, niet echt. De oplossing lag in een combinatie van het gebruik van een in-memory database en een kolomgebaseerde manier van gegevens verwerken. Dit laatste zorgt ervoor dat gegevens efficiënt kunnen worden opgehaald, omdat alleen relevante gegevens worden opgehaald in plaats van hele records rij per rij. Het resultaat is een extreem vereenvoudigde tabelstructuur. Grote hoeveelheden gegevens kunnen in één tabel worden opgeslagen zonder dat dit ten koste gaat van de verwerkingssnelheid van gegevens. Traditionele aggregatietabellen zijn overbodig geworden. De 'universal journal' tabellen binnen Finance zijn hier het beste voorbeeld van.

Terug naar de valkuil: bestaande SAP software moest worden geoptimaliseerd voor het gebruik van de nieuwe, vereenvoudigde tabellen om de kracht van HANA ten volle te benutten. Maar SAP is zo rijk aan functionaliteit dat niet alles in één keer kon worden gedaan. Grote delen zijn al verbeterd, maar bij elke release wordt nog steeds nieuwe functionaliteit aangeboden. Natuurlijk geoptimaliseerd voor HANA.

Bij Emixa zijn we voortdurend op de hoogte van de laatste ontwikkelingen en roadmaps van SAP. Dit maakt ons een ambassadeur van SAP's visie op automatisering en meer analytisch inzicht. Partijen die dit niet doen en vertrouwen op verouderde kennis en implementatiemethoden, lopen de kans in de val te lopen van het gebruik van "oude" functionaliteit of verminderd gebruiksgemak. Zonde, want dan haal je niet het maximale uit het moderne IT-platform dat SAP met S/4HANA biedt!

Figuur 1. Een voorbeeld van hoe transactionele gegevens direct beschikbaar zijn in analytische weergaven

Valkuil 2: denken in grote projecten

Traditionele implementatiemethoden gaan vaak gepaard met grote projecten. Bij voorkeur volgens de watervalmethode met duidelijke kaders en doelstellingen vooraf vanuit de IT-afdeling.

De IT-afdeling vindt veranderingen in het ERP landschap (zoals innovaties) vaak eng, werkt traag en is in wezen bedoeld om te behouden wat er al is. De bekende slogan "Don't fix what ain't broke" beschrijft deze traditionele houding misschien wel het beste.

Dit staat in schril contrast met de steeds veeleisender wordende bedrijfsvoering. Vooral de gevestigde orde lijdt onder verlangzaming van dit proces en verliest het van snel innoverende start-ups of scale-ups. Ook de snelheid waarmee (IT-)innovaties plaatsvinden is een probleem met deze traditionele manier van denken. Een transformatieproject dat jaren duurt is niet langer rendabel. Tegen de tijd dat de organisatie de implementatie heeft afgerond, is het systeem verouderd.

Een low-code platform biedt flexibiliteit

Wat nodig is, is een werkwijze die flexibiliteit verkiest boven projectstabiliteit en risicomijdend gedrag. Het stelt ook technische eisen aan de ERP oplossing. Doordat SAP niet langer één modulair systeem is, maar zich gedraagt als een technologieplatform, worden technische diepgang en integratiecomplexiteit geëlimineerd. De aanpak, die gebaseerd is op best practices, garandeert standaardisatie en harmonisatie waar "goed" goed genoeg is. Snelheid en flexibiliteit worden specifiek geboden voor competitief onderscheidende processen die behoren tot de innovatielaag in het systeemlandschap, bijvoorbeeld via Mendix als low-code platform.

Het resultaat: een modulair, flexibel en wendbaar landschap en een 'Composable ERP'. Dit heeft één oplossing per hoofdproces en beperkt daardoor het aantal leveranciers. Leveranciers worden hiermee strategische partners, ze begrijpen de situatie, de uitdagingen en ambities.

Valkuil 3: IT-gestuurde S/4HANA-implementaties

In lijn met valkuil 2 komt het vaak voor dat implementaties IT-gedreven zijn. Het bestaande systeem is verouderd en wordt niet meer ondersteund. Er wordt een eenvoudige business case gemaakt of bedrijfsrisico's worden afgewogen en de opdracht in dergelijke situaties is "implementeer een nieuwe ERP".

Het probleem met een dergelijke opdracht is dat het silo's onvoldoende overstijgt. De opdracht biedt geen ruimte voor een bedrijfsarchitectuur gebaseerd op waardecreatie.

Van IT-gestuurd naar bedrijfsgestuurd

Wat nodig is, is een bedrijfsgerichte aanpak met een missie als: "efficiëntere en effectievere bedrijfsvoering". Alleen dan ontstaat een End-to-End aanpak vanuit een ketengedachte. Er zijn sleutelfunctionarissen nodig van elke afdeling met een echt begrip van de bedrijfsprocessen en de bijbehorende uitdagingen.

 

Figuur 2. Van IT-gestuurd naar business-gestuurd.

Haal het meeste uit SAP S/4HANA

Deze valkuilen zijn niet bedoeld als demotivatoren. Integendeel, pas als je deze valkuilen juist herkent kun je passende maatregelen nemen.

Toch laten deze valkuilen zien dat een grootschalige ERP implementatie niet onderschat moet worden. De juiste (implementatie)partner (we hebben immers gezien dat partnerschap verder gaat dan alleen implementatie) is cruciaal. Deze voorkomt deze en andere valkuilen en verhoogt zo het rendement van uw investering.

Klaar voor een zakelijke verandering? Op Emixa delen we graag onze uitgebreide inzichten. Neem contact met ons op om te ontdekken hoe onze aanpak uw organisatie kan helpen te gedijen in het cloud-tijdperk. Laten we samen op weg gaan naar meer efficiëntie en effectiviteit!

Patrick Beks

Als directeur technologie en innovatie speelt Patrick een cruciale rol in het stimuleren van technologische innovatie, het bevorderen van een cultuur van voortdurende verbetering en het behouden van het concurrentievoordeel van Emixa binnen de markt.